OpenOffice 4.1.15 running on Ubuntu 24.04 seems to run well... But:
[1] AT CLOSE, I get the notice: "Sorry, Ubuntu 24.04 has experienced an internal error"
Integrity of the files I was working on seem fine when opened; this warning seems ominous indicating something isn't right with the settings on OpenOffice, or perhaps with the Linux OS on which its running. File saves while working seem fine; file integrity have displayed no save issues. User reports have gone out on the "internal error" item repeatedly. No reply, no updates, the problem persists. [2] AT OPEN, (lesser issue) the windows are sometimes oddly nested, not full window (as I usually have it) and won't be interacted with until minimized and re-maximized. That issue is inconsistent, I haven't narrowed conditions under which this occurs, and I haven't yet caught a screen shot of that issue.

That SIGSEGV error often pops up some few seconds after after closing a large file on OpenOffice 4.1.15 on Xubuntu 22.04.5: the Saved files are perfectly OK, so I just ignore it.
I get no error and notice no oddities on opening a file, but I normally don't have multiple OpenOffice files open.
